summaryrefslogtreecommitdiff
path: root/util
diff options
context:
space:
mode:
authorEarl Ou <shunhsingou@google.com>2017-10-06 20:55:41 +0800
committerGabe Black <gabeblack@google.com>2018-01-11 23:33:31 +0000
commitcc51037e8074949bc9e7638babfb597490d007ec (patch)
tree9f5bbe0f66dbc2c33d2610ec62bd77a8d0e0fe39 /util
parentb622601dfbabfb7cebf1a6df2eb8b0440d8365cb (diff)
downloadgem5-cc51037e8074949bc9e7638babfb597490d007ec.tar.xz
util/m5: add Android.mk
Add Android.mk so we can build m5 tool in Android tree. Change-Id: I7023130bd3ce5e015b8f7c41941eafb4611da8cb Reviewed-on: https://gem5-review.googlesource.com/7363 Reviewed-by: Jason Lowe-Power <jason@lowepower.com> Maintainer: Gabe Black <gabeblack@google.com>
Diffstat (limited to 'util')
-rw-r--r--util/m5/Android.mk21
1 files changed, 21 insertions, 0 deletions
diff --git a/util/m5/Android.mk b/util/m5/Android.mk
new file mode 100644
index 000000000..34fb10ec9
--- /dev/null
+++ b/util/m5/Android.mk
@@ -0,0 +1,21 @@
+LOCAL_PATH := $(call my-dir)
+include $(CLEAR_VARS)
+
+LOCAL_MODULE := m5
+LOCAL_SRC_FILES := \
+ m5.c
+
+ifeq ($(TARGET_ARCH),x86)
+ LOCAL_SRC_FILES += \
+ m5op_x86.S
+else ifeq ($(TARGET_ARCH),arm)
+ LOCAL_SRC_FILES += \
+ m5op_arm.S
+else ifeq ($(TARGET_ARCH),arm64)
+ LOCAL_SRC_FILES += \
+ m5op_arm_A64.S
+else
+ $(error "Unsupported TARGET_ARCH $(TARGET_ARCH)")
+endif
+
+include $(BUILD_EXECUTABLE)